OE MATCH Pistons and cylinders

JE Forgings are made from 2618 Aluminum, They have a 0 offset with extra material under the top for the valve pockets. The Cast Iron Liners come with out the head gasket grove.
Engine size: 2.7
Stroke: 70.4
Cylinders: Cast Iron
Pistons: JE 2618 Forged
Dome CC: 25.5
Compression: 10.5:1
Kit includes: 6 Cylinders, 6 Pistons, A set of Piston Rings, and 6 wrist pins and clips.

The cylinder kit forms the combustion chamber walls and provides the precision-machined surfaces required for the pistons and piston rings to create efficient compression and combustion. Cast iron construction offers excellent dimensional stability and durability under continuous operating conditions. Over time, repeated piston movement, heat cycles, and normal engine wear can cause cylinder bores to become worn, tapered, scored, or distorted, resulting in reduced compression, increased oil consumption, and declining engine performance. Replacing worn cylinders restores engine efficiency, improves sealing, and supports dependable long-term operation.

Symptoms Of Wear Or Failure:
- Low engine compression.
- Excessive oil consumption.
- Blue exhaust smoke caused by oil burning.
- Loss of engine power or performance.
- Excessive crankcase blow-by.
- Scored, worn, or tapered cylinder bores.
- Piston slap or abnormal engine noise.
- Damage identified during engine overhaul.

Why Do Pistons & Cylinders Fail?
Over time, pistons and cylinders wear due to heat, friction,
and combustion forces. Common failure causes include:
- Cylinder bore wear or scoring.
- Piston skirt wear from high mileage.
- Oil starvation or contamination.
- Overheating causing piston expansion or seizure.
- Loss of compression due to worn rings or bores.
These issues can lead to oil consumption, power loss, poor starting, and eventual engine failure.
